IMAGE DESCRIPTION: 

It took some time to find an appropriate subject that conveys loneliness. I
first thought of the usual things (howling wolves in icy landscapes, light
houses on rocks near the ocean) but decided these were not original enough.
Then I thought of how you could feel lonely while still having people all 
around you. And this brought me to the subway... I'm not sure if it makes
sense, but it looks lonely enough to me. The text on the poem (lying on the
floor, not meant to be readable) reads: ALONE IS A STATE\OF MIND\Surrounded
by many people\that all can talk\yet all are quiet\Life passing by\outside
the window\city/dark/city/dark\And so we travel\though together\I have
never  felt more alone. The graffiti (on the wall, should be readable) 
reads "ALONE". There are also scratches on the left window. In my country,
this is the most favourite form of graffiti: long-lasting and inexpensive
(just use a key). It also reads "ALONE", but should be relatively 
unreadable.


DESCRIPTION OF HOW THIS IMAGE WAS CREATED: 

I like programming all the objects myself in the POVRAY scene language. I
especially enjoyed doing the bends in the pipes. The graffiti was made 
using a simple paint programme and converted into a  transparant PNG file 
using Photoshop. The poem was first written on paper and then scanned.
